I just look at who visited my page and if they are local I message them and say “Hi, thank you for visiting my profile. I hope all is well” I will also periodically check in with clients I’ve had sessions with in the past and I will update my profile picture to get more eyeballs on my page.If you are really struggling you can run a promotion but you don’t wanna do that too often and be prepared for the fact that some people will just take advantage of the sale price but will not become regular customers once you go back to your full price.
